The AirTAC GFR40010ALJF1T AirTAC Filter Regulator NPT3/8 Low-Pressure is a genuine G-series filter regulator: water separation, 40 µm particulate filtration and balanced-type pressure regulation combined in a single body. It has PT3/8" ports, a automatic drain and regulates 0.15 - 0.9 MPa (20 - 130 psi). It does not lubricate — add a GL lubricator, or order the GFC two-unit set, if downstream equipment needs oil.
The AirTAC GFR40010ALJF1T is a GFR-series filter regulator: water and particulate filtration plus pressure regulation combined in a single body. This 400-size unit is threaded NPT3/8 (3/8 in), carries the standard 40 um filter element, and is fitted with an automatic drain, so collected condensate is expelled without manual attention. The regulator is the low-pressure type, and the embedded square gauge (MPa scale) lets you read and set downstream pressure directly at the unit. No mounting bracket is included in this configuration.
This is a genuine AirTAC part from the GFR400 series. The GFR line is offered in sizes 200, 300, 400 and 600 with a choice of drain type (differential-pressure, automatic or manual), a 5 um optional element (code W), gauge style and scale, and PT, G or NPT threads. | GFR400 | G-series filter regulator, 400 body — sets the port range. |
|---|---|
| 10 | Port size PT3/8". This body offers 10 = PT3/8", 15 = PT1/2". |
| A | Drain: Automatic drain — this also sets the regulating band (0.15 - 0.9 MPa (20 - 130 psi)). |
| L | Low-pressure type. Blank is standard, L is the low-pressure type. |
| J | Supplied without bracket. |
| (blank) | Pressure gauge fitted (blank). |
| F | Gauge shape: Square. C is round, F is square. |
| 1 | Gauge scale: MPa. 1 is MPa, 2 is psi, 3 is bar. |
| (blank) | Filtering grade 40 µm. Only 40 µm (blank) and 5 µm (W) exist. |
| T | NPT thread. PT is the default; G is BSPP and T is NPT. |
| (blank) | No reverse-flow valve (the default). |
Field order is size, port, drain, type, bracket, gauge, shape, scale, grade, thread, reflux — a blank position takes the default. Example: GFR300-08 is a 300 body, PT1/4", differential drain, standard type, bracket included, gauge fitted, 40 µm, PT thread, no reflux valve.
A larger body carries a larger port and holds set pressure better as flow rises. AirTAC publishes flow only as curves, so size the body from your peak demand with headroom. The GFR600 uses an aluminium-alloy bowl; the 200, 300 and 400 bodies use PC.

Feeding clamp cylinders on a CNC fixture line: the GFR40010ALJF1T cleans water and chips-laden condensate out of the shop air and holds a steady low-pressure setting for consistent clamping force, with the automatic drain keeping the bowl clear between shifts.
Upstream of the valve manifold on a cartoning or wrapping machine: the 3/8 in port matches the machine's main air drop, the 40 um element protects directional valves from particulate, and the MPa gauge gives operators a visible setpoint at the unit.
A filtered, regulated branch feeding several workstations on a factory floor: the low-pressure regulator type suits circuits that run below typical line pressure, and the automatic drain suits a drop point that nobody empties by hand.
